[llvm] r329021 - Fix Go IR test for changes in DIBuilder API
Harlan Haskins via llvm-commits
llvm-commits at lists.llvm.org
Mon Apr 2 14:45:36 PDT 2018
Author: harlanhaskins
Date: Mon Apr 2 14:45:35 2018
New Revision: 329021
URL: http://llvm.org/viewvc/llvm-project?rev=329021&view=rev
Log:
Fix Go IR test for changes in DIBuilder API
Modified:
llvm/trunk/bindings/go/llvm/ir_test.go
Modified: llvm/trunk/bindings/go/llvm/ir_test.go
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/bindings/go/llvm/ir_test.go?rev=329021&r1=329020&r2=329021&view=diff
==============================================================================
--- llvm/trunk/bindings/go/llvm/ir_test.go (original)
+++ llvm/trunk/bindings/go/llvm/ir_test.go Mon Apr 2 14:45:35 2018
@@ -112,7 +112,11 @@ func TestDebugLoc(t *testing.T) {
}()
file := d.CreateFile("dummy_file", "dummy_dir")
voidInfo := d.CreateBasicType(DIBasicType{Name: "void"})
- typeInfo := d.CreateSubroutineType(DISubroutineType{file, []Metadata{voidInfo}})
+ typeInfo := d.CreateSubroutineType(DISubroutineType{
+ File: file,
+ Parameters: []Metadata{voidInfo},
+ Flags: 0,
+ })
scope := d.CreateFunction(file, DIFunction{
Name: "foo",
LinkageName: "foo",
More information about the llvm-commits
mailing list